Understanding Condom Materials

When it comes to choosing the right condom, understanding the materials they’re made from is crucial. Different materials offer unique benefits and may even affect your comfort and safety. Let’s dive into the various types of condom materials and what you need to know about each one.

Types of Condom Materials

There are several types of condom materials available, and knowing the differences can help you make a more informed choice. Latex condoms are the most common and offer great protection against STIs and pregnancy. Polyurethane condoms are a good option for those with latex allergies and provide a different feel. Polyisoprene condoms are stretchy and comfortable while also being effective against STIs. Natural membrane condoms, made from lambskin, allow for heat transfer but don’t protect against STIs.

Polyurethane vs. Polyisoprene

Polyurethane and polyisoprene condoms both offer reliable protection, but you might find one material fits your preferences better than the other. If you’re sensitive to latex, polyisoprene could be the better choice for you. Polyurethane condoms are often thinner, which might enhance sensitivity during use. On the other hand, polyisoprene condoms provide a softer feel that some users prefer. Both materials are effective, so it’s worth trying each to see what works best for you.

Choosing Based on Allergies

Choosing the right condom based on allergies can make a significant difference in your comfort and safety. If you’re allergic to latex, opting for polyisoprene or polyurethane condoms is a smart choice. You’ll want to check the packaging to ensure the condoms are labeled as latex-free. It’s also important to consider any sensitivities you might have to other materials. By knowing your allergies, you can make a more informed decision that enhances your experience.

Sizing and Fit Considerations

Finding the right size and fit is essential for comfort and effectiveness during use. You should measure your length and girth to choose the best condom for your needs. If it’s too tight, it might break, while a loose fit could slip off. Don’t hesitate to try different brands, as sizing can vary. Always check the packaging for sizing information to ensure a proper fit.

Safety and Expiration Dates

Safety is crucial, so always check the expiration date on the condom package before use. If a condom’s past its expiration date, it’s best to discard it and grab a new one. Expired condoms can be less effective and may break more easily. You’re making a smart choice by prioritizing your safety and your partner’s. Always store condoms in a cool, dry place to help maintain their integrity.
